Deacon Lewis Gene Jackson, 71, passed away Thursday, February 1, 2019.

Service Information: Funeral service will be held at 11AM, Saturday, February 9, at Greater New Light Missionary Baptist Church, 925 N 18th st in Waco. Burial will follow at Oakwood Cemetery. Visitation will be held from 6 to 8PM, Friday, February 8, at Lake Shore Funeral Home.

Lewis was born September 24, 1947 to Clover Gene (Denson) and Henry Lewis Jackson in Wichita Falls. Lewis ran track in High School and received a scholarship to a Christian university. He married the love of his life, Doris Banks, on May 5, 1971 in Lawton, OK. He joined church at a young age in Wichita Falls and later in his life he was a member of the Greater New Life Missionary Baptist Church where he drove the Sunday School Bus. Lewis served 22 years in the United States Air Force. While severing, he obtained his Associates Degree and fought in the Vietnam War. Following his service in the military, he had a 19 year career with the United States Postal Service.

Lewis loved to joke with friends and family and was an easy going person. He enjoyed spending time with his family and friends.

He is preceded in death by his father; and brothers, Lester Jackson and Sylvester Jackson.

Survivors include his wife of 49 years, Doris Jackson; son, Tyrone Jackson; daughters, Tiffany Elaine Jackson- Stevens and husband, Robert, Lisa Allison and husband, Donald, and Jackie Jackson; mother, Clover Jackson; sisters, Mary William and Betty Jackson; sisters-in-law, Laura Jenkins and husband, Howard, Linda McClendon, and Delores Bartley; brothers-in-law, Major E.E. Banks and Stanley Banks; and numerous grandchildren, great-grandchildren, nieces, nephews and friends.
